Landau level of fragile topology

Biao Lian,Fang Xie,B. Bernevig

Published 2018 in Physical Review B

ABSTRACT

The flat bands in twisted bilayer graphene (TBG) are known to carry a new type of topology called fragile topology. Here, the authors show that the flat bands in TBG have their Hofstadter butterfly generically connected with the Hofstadter butterfly of the higher bands, which is a topological signature of the fragile topology. This leads to Landau level gaps extending over multiple bands and closing the zero magnetic field band gaps, which is detectable by transport experiments in magnetic fields.
